手机号码定位技术实战5分钟构建免费查询系统【免费下载链接】location-to-phone-numberThis a project to search a location of a specified phone number, and locate the map to the phone number location.项目地址: https://gitcode.com/gh_mirrors/lo/location-to-phone-number你是否曾想过仅凭一个手机号码就能快速定位到用户所在的城市location-to-phone-number项目为你提供了这样的能力。这个基于ASP.NET的开源解决方案通过简单的Web界面和Google Maps集成让你在几分钟内搭建起专业的手机号码归属地查询系统。无论是客服系统优化、安全监控还是市场分析这个工具都能为你提供精准的地理位置信息。 核心价值为什么你需要手机号码定位系统解决的实际问题在数字化运营中地理位置信息往往蕴含着巨大的商业价值。传统的位置获取方式需要复杂的API集成和高昂的费用而location-to-phone-number项目打破了这一限制客服效率提升来电时自动显示客户所在城市提供针对性服务安全风险预警检测异常登录地点及时触发二次验证物流路线优化根据收件人归属地智能分配最近配送点精准营销投放基于地区特征推送个性化促销活动技术优势相比商业API服务这个开源项目具有以下独特优势完全免费无需支付任何服务费用开箱即用预配置Web服务无需复杂设置轻量级架构基于ASP.NET Web Forms资源消耗低可视化展示集成Google Maps直观显示地理位置 快速开始5分钟搭建系统第一步环境准备确保你的开发环境支持ASP.NET框架这是项目运行的基础要求。如果你使用的是Visual Studio可以直接打开解决方案文件。第二步获取源代码git clone https://gitcode.com/gh_mirrors/lo/location-to-phone-number cd location-to-phone-number第三步配置检查打开web.config文件确认Web服务配置正确。关键配置位于App_WebReferences/CellPhoneWebXml/目录包含了手机号码查询服务的引用。第四步启动服务将项目部署到IIS服务器或在Visual Studio中直接运行调试模式。系统会自动加载所有必要组件。第五步功能验证访问系统首页输入测试手机号码如13800138000点击Locate按钮系统将在地图上显示该号码的归属地信息。 技术深度解析系统架构与实现核心模块设计项目采用经典的ASP.NET Web Forms架构主要包含三个层次1. 数据服务层(App_WebReferences/CellPhoneWebXml/)通过MobileCodeWS Web服务获取手机号码归属地信息支持中国三大运营商的号码查询返回格式化的地理位置数据2. 业务逻辑层(Default.aspx.cs)[WebMethod] public static string GetMobileCodeInfo(string code) { string result new MobileCodeWS().getMobileCodeInfo(code, ); return result; }处理手机号码查询的核心逻辑调用Web服务并返回结果支持异步调用提升响应速度3. 前端展示层(Default.aspx)集成Google Maps API v2提供直观的地图展示界面支持地图与卫星视图切换实现定位标记和信息窗口查询流程详解用户在输入框中输入11位手机号码前端JavaScript调用后端WebMethod后端通过MobileCodeWS服务查询归属地返回格式化的地理位置信息前端使用Google Maps Geocoder转换为坐标在地图上标记位置并显示详细信息系统界面展示简洁的输入区域与地图可视化组件 实战应用四个典型场景场景一客服系统增强集成到现有客服平台中当客户来电时自动显示归属地信息客服人员可以根据地区特点提供更贴心的服务。实现要点监听来电事件提取手机号码调用GetMobileCodeInfo方法获取归属地在客服界面显示地区信息根据地区推荐相应服务场景二安全监控系统在企业内部系统中监控员工的登录地点当检测到异常地区登录时触发安全警报。配置示例// 登录时检查用户归属地 function checkLoginLocation(phoneNumber) { PageMethods.GetMobileCodeInfo(phoneNumber, function(result) { var location extractLocation(result); if (isSuspiciousLocation(location)) { triggerTwoFactorAuth(); } }); }场景三物流配送优化电商平台根据收件人手机号码的归属地智能分配最近的仓库或配送站点。优化策略批量处理订单中的手机号码按地区聚类分配配送任务减少配送距离降低成本提高配送时效场景四市场营销分析分析用户群体的地域分布制定针对性的营销策略和推广活动。数据分析维度用户地域热力图地区消费偏好分析营销活动效果追踪区域市场渗透率️ 配置与定制指南关键配置文件web.config- 系统主配置文件appSettings add keyCellPhoneWebXml.MobileCodeWS valuehttp://www.webxml.com.cn/WebServices/MobileCodeWS.asmx/ /appSettings界面样式定制(App_Themes/default/StyleSheet.css)修改颜色主题和字体调整布局和响应式设计自定义地图控件样式系统蓝色渐变背景设计营造专业科技感性能优化建议启用缓存机制对于频繁查询的号码建立本地缓存异步处理大量查询时使用异步调用避免阻塞错误重试网络不稳定时自动重试失败请求日志记录详细记录查询日志便于问题排查⚠️ 避坑指南常见问题与解决方案问题一查询返回空结果可能原因号码格式错误或Web服务不可用解决方案确认号码为11位有效手机号码检查网络连接是否正常验证Web服务配置是否正确问题二地图无法加载可能原因Google Maps API密钥问题或网络限制解决方案检查API密钥配置确认网络环境可以访问Google服务考虑使用替代地图服务问题三响应速度慢可能原因网络延迟或服务负载高解决方案实现本地缓存机制使用异步查询方式考虑部署到更近的服务器问题四精度不足可能原因Web服务数据更新不及时解决方案定期更新Web服务引用考虑集成多个数据源添加用户反馈机制修正数据 高级功能扩展批量查询优化虽然系统设计为单次查询但可以通过简单扩展实现批量处理public Liststring BatchQuery(Liststring phoneNumbers) { var results new Liststring(); foreach(var number in phoneNumbers) { var info GetMobileCodeInfo(number); results.Add(${number}: {info}); } return results; }数据导出功能添加CSV或Excel导出功能便于进一步的数据分析实现数据格式化模块添加导出按钮和界面支持多种格式导出包含查询时间和结果信息多地图服务集成除了Google Maps可以集成百度地图、高德地图等国内服务创建地图服务抽象层实现多个地图提供者根据用户选择动态切换保持统一的API接口 最佳实践与建议合规使用原则尊重用户隐私仅用于合法合规的业务场景数据安全妥善存储查询记录防止泄露透明告知明确告知用户数据使用目的定期审计检查系统使用情况确保合规性能监控指标建立系统监控机制关注以下关键指标查询响应时间平均应在1-3秒内成功率目标达到99%以上并发处理能力支持多用户同时查询系统可用性确保7×24小时服务持续优化方向基于实际使用反馈建议关注以下优化方向智能识别功能区分个人和企业号码国际号码支持扩展国际号码查询能力移动端适配优化手机和平板用户体验数据可视化增强添加热力图、轨迹分析等功能 立即开始你的定位之旅location-to-phone-number项目为你提供了一个简单、免费且功能完整的手机号码定位解决方案。无论你是个人开发者想要学习相关技术还是企业需要集成定位功能这个项目都能为你提供强大的技术支持和实践参考。下一步行动建议立即体验按照快速开始指南搭建系统功能测试使用不同地区的手机号码测试系统集成尝试将系统集成到你的现有项目中反馈贡献在使用过程中发现问题或改进建议欢迎参与项目改进记住技术的价值在于实际应用。通过这个项目你不仅获得了一个实用的工具更掌握了手机号码定位技术的核心原理。现在就开始你的实践之旅探索地理位置信息带来的无限可能提示项目所有源代码和配置文件均已开源你可以根据业务需求自由定制和扩展。如果在使用过程中遇到任何问题建议查阅项目文档或参与技术社区讨论。【免费下载链接】location-to-phone-numberThis a project to search a location of a specified phone number, and locate the map to the phone number location.项目地址: https://gitcode.com/gh_mirrors/lo/location-to-phone-number创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考